- 1. v. i. To emit air, chiefly through the nose, audibly and violently, by a kind of involuntary convulsive force, occasioned by irritation of the inner membrane of the nose. Source: opted
- 2. n. A sudden and violent ejection of air with an audible sound, chiefly through the nose. Source: opted
- 3. n. a symptom consisting of the involuntary expulsion of air from the nose Source: wordnet
- 4. v. exhale spasmodically, as when an irritant entered one's nose Source: wordnet
